Allow yourself to be captivated by the mysterious glow of radium in an evening filled with mystery, history and fun!

Every season, the MEM invites visitors to a unique happy hour event. With music, drinks at the bar, and an original theme, the atmosphere is fun and relaxed. Welcome to off-the-wall evenings!

For this edition, discover the exhibition, "A Ray of Hope? The Institut du Radium de Montréal Against Cancer" and allow yourself to be guided by the beams lighting up the museum. Once a symbol of modernity and exciting discoveries, radium fascinated people with its strange glow, promises and seemingly magical qualities.

This off-the-wall evening is inspired by this fascination — a mix of radiance, curiosities and stories that marked the 1900s. On the program: a retro musical ambiance from the past century, a cocktail of mysterious fluorescent emanations, and a challenge worthy of the greatest scientists.
